Manchester United defender Nemanja Vidic is out of the clash with West Ham but Wayne Rooney is set to return to the bench.

Vidic missed the Champions League win over Barcelona in midweek because of the effects of a collision with Chelsea striker Didier Drogba which left him with a tooth missing and cuts to his mouth.

The Serb will again miss out but Rooney is set to defy a hip problem and should at least be named among the substitutes.

Patrice Evra has also been passed fit to take on the Hammers after being stretchered off in midweek.

"Wayne may be on the bench," said Red Devils boss Sir Alex Ferguson. "But we've got a major final to think about and we're not going to rush him."
